ESPERANDO UN 2 DE NOVIEMBRE | DIR. Jorge Alberto Alvarez Torres | Mexico | 2019 | 2:49 min
Doña Alicia prepares her altar for someone very special; when her grandson takes her to get pan de muerto, a peculiar character steps in at that very moment to finish the task in honor of her loved one.
EL DÍA QUE YO ME VAYA | Dir. Alejandra Ríos | Mexico | 2017 | 5 min
After losing her home in the 19S earthquake (2017), Doña Mago prepares the Day of the Dead ofrenda to welcome her husband, who passed away a year earlier. Meanwhile, the town of Santa Rosa Xochiac, in the Álvaro Obregón borough, celebrates the “Primera cera” tradition to honor its dead.
CAMINAR LOS DÍAS | Dir. Arturo González Villaseñor | Mexico | 2017 | 5 min.
Mariana has found work at the bakery, a temporary job during pan de muerto season. She lives with her brother Diego, whom she has cared for since their mother's disappearance. Immersed in a day devoted to venerating death, they live it through absence.
ACÁ EN LA TIERRA | Dir. Rebeca Trejo | Mexico | 2018 | 13 min.
Sam is an alien child, or so he thinks, and he has come on a mission that not even he understands, so he keeps a log on his tape recorder while he waits for instructions. Soon he'll have to adapt to earthlings, which turns out to be quite complicated, because he doesn't understand much about their behavior, nor their terrible need to classify everything, nor their habits of sorting everything — so he prefers solitude, and listening to music on his walkman.
ANTES DE ENTRAR PERMITA SALIR | Dir. Alfonso Coronel | Mexico | 2019 | 13:30 min
A documentary exploring a day in the working life of a Mexico City Metro driver, known on social media as the Mexican “Wolverine.” It gives an introspective account of his lifestyle and experiences.
